  • Abstract
    This paper presents a new formulation for geometrically non-linear problems and their numerical treatment by the p-version of the nite element method. The formulation is characterized by a weak form based on the spatial representation of the equilibrium equations, a deformed geometry mapped by the displacement eld, a natural description for non-conservative loads that keeps the symmetry of the equations, and a direct (non-incremental) iterative algorithm to solve the equations. The paper is concerned only with problems for which the solution is unique, i.e. the load{displacement curves are single-valued, and the strains are small. Examples are presented.
